资源描述:
《面向服务架构论文基于SOA的应用集成设计研究》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、面向服务架构论文:基于SOA的应用集成设计研究【中文摘要】随着信息技术和网络技术的发展,出现了各种基于不同平台的应用系统。对于企业用户,很容易陷入多种应用系统交织在一起的混乱局面当中,由于基于不同平台的应用系统之间很难实现信息共享,所以最终导致信息孤岛的形成。从企业的现状来看,对现有应用系统进行集成,可以节约软件投资,保证现有系统继续使用,是目前消除信息孤岛的最佳途径。由于传统的应用集成实现技术存在紧密耦合、交互性差、可扩展性差等不足,本文将面向服务的架构引入到应用系统集成研究中,从面向服务集成的
2、核心技术SOA和Web服务理论入手,按一个SOA项开发流程,分别论述了面向服务的需求分析与设计、面向服务集成的开发及面向服务集成的案例实现。在分析与设计部分,总结了SOA建模的原则和服务建模的过程。在开发部分,设计了一个SOA分层架构模型并对每层开发的服务进行了详细论述。SOA分层架构的核心思想是运用SOA理论将企业现有的信息系统分解成多个独立的粗粒度Web服务,信息的集成即变成Web服务之间的交互,从而隐藏了原信息系统的位置和实现技术。Web服务还可进行灵活的组合,形成不同的业务工作流,满足企业
3、随需而变的需要,更加突出基于SOA面向服务的集成与平台无关、易于扩展、易于集成等特点。最后通过冀东水泥企业集成平台的建设实例分析SOA项实践。【英文摘要】Withthedevelopmentofinformationtechnologyandnetworktechnique,variousofapplicationsystemsbasedondifferentplatformsappear.Forenterprise,itisveryeasytofallintotheconfusionofinte
4、rlacingwithmanyapplicationsystems.Informationsharingamongtheapplicationsystemsbasedondifferentplatformsishardtoimplement,thus,thesolitaryinformationislandisformedinsideenterprise.Integratingthedifferenttypesofapplicationsystemsisthebestwaytoeliminates
5、olitaryinformationislandatpresent,becausetheexistingsystemscanbeusedcontinuouslyandtheinvestmentinthemcanbesaved.Aimedatthetraditionalintegrationtechnique’sshortageswhicharetightcoupling,badinteractivityandbadextendibility,thisthesisintroducesSOA(Serv
6、ice-OrientedArchitecture)intothestudiesofapplicationsystemsintegration.ItstartswiththecoretechniqueofSOAandthetheoryofwebservice,analysesthedemandofserviceoriented,anddiscussesthedesign,exploitationandcaserealizationofSOA.Inthepartofanalysisanddesign,
7、itsummarizestheSOAmodellingprincipleandtheservicemodellingprocess.Inthedevelopmentpart,itdesignsaSOAlaminationconstructionmodelandcarriesonthedetailedelaborationtoeachdevelopmentservice.ThiscorethoughtofthearchitectureisusingtheSOAtheorytodecomposethe
8、enterpriseexistinginformationsystemsintoanumberofindependentcoarsegranularitywebservice.Webinformationintegrationnamelyturnsbetweenthewebserviceinteractive,thustheoriginalinformationsystempositionandtherealizationtechnologyarehidden.Thewebserv